| I've got a png image with its background color set to RGB 0, 0, 0.  When I try to use the image the images background keeps showing through, why?  Below is my Draw method, any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ks ' draw the city Method Draw() SetBlend MASKBLEND SetAlpha 1 SetScale .4, .4 SetRotation 0 DrawImage city, x, y End Method |

| umm,.... MASKBLEND lets the background show through, that's what it's for. If you want to show the black pixels use SOLIDBLEND. |

| I found out the problem, I had selected CMYK in photoshop.  I changed it to RGB and it worked as it should.  Thanks for everyones input. |
